Output 23caafb73dce4e101f2c7cef13561cc83cce4f2a32df6af1619073f432d1a147:0

value
803083
script pubkey
OP_0 OP_PUSHBYTES_20 944b7fb4b27efefea91367e052c0f43fc07edc39
address
bc1qj39hld9j0ml0a2gnvls99s858lq8ahpemwpmpd
transaction
23caafb73dce4e101f2c7cef13561cc83cce4f2a32df6af1619073f432d1a147
spent
true